Empowering Strength: 9 Reasons Why Girls Should Embrace Lifting Weights

In a world that is gradually shifting towards inclusivity and breaking down gender stereotypes, the realm of fitness is no exception. Girls lifting weights is a powerful movement gaining momentum, and it's time to celebrate the myriad benefits that weightlifting brings to the table. In this article, we'll explore nine compelling reasons why girls should wholeheartedly embrace lifting weights and make it an integral part of their fitness journey.

 


1. Strength, Not Bulk: Dispelling the Myth of Bulking Up

One common misconception that often discourages women from lifting weights is the fear of bulking up. It's crucial to emphasize that weightlifting, when done properly, does not automatically lead to a bulky physique. In fact, it helps in toning and sculpting muscles, creating a lean and strong body.

2. Body Confidence: Sculpting More Than Just Muscles

Beyond physical strength, weightlifting has a profound impact on body confidence. Engaging in strength training fosters a positive relationship with one's body, promoting self-acceptance and appreciation for what it can achieve.

3. Mental Resilience: Lifting Weights, Lifting Spirits

The benefits of weightlifting extend far beyond the physical realm. The mental resilience developed through challenging workouts can empower girls to face life's obstacles with a newfound strength. The discipline and determination required in the weight room translate into a resilient mindset outside of it.

4. Empowering Independence: Taking Control of Your Fitness Journey

Girls who embrace weightlifting gain a sense of empowerment and independence in their fitness journey. Unlike some workout routines that may rely on external factors, weightlifting allows individuals to take control of their progress, set personal goals, and achieve them through dedication and hard work.

5. Efficient Fat Loss: Boosting Metabolism with Strength Training

Weightlifting is a highly effective tool for fat loss. As muscle mass increases, so does the body's metabolism. This means that even when not actively working out, individuals who lift weights burn more calories at rest, contributing to efficient fat loss over time.

6. Bone Health: Strengthening the Foundation for Life

Especially crucial for girls and women, weightlifting plays a significant role in enhancing bone health. As they age, the risk of osteoporosis increases, making weight-bearing exercises like lifting crucial for maintaining strong and healthy bones.

7. Versatility in Workouts: Breaking the Monotony

Weightlifting introduces a diverse range of exercises that add versatility to workout routines. From compound movements like squats and deadlifts to isolation exercises, incorporating weightlifting ensures that workouts remain interesting and challenging, preventing the monotony that can lead to exercise burnout.

8. Functional Fitness: Preparing for Real-Life Challenges

Girls who lift weights aren't just building strength for the gym; they are enhancing their functional fitness for everyday life. Whether lifting groceries, moving furniture, or tackling physical challenges, the strength gained from weightlifting proves invaluable in real-world situations.

9. Community and Support: Joining the Rise of Women in the Weight Room

As more girls embrace weightlifting, a supportive community is emerging. Breaking stereotypes and joining a community of like-minded individuals fosters a sense of belonging and encourages girls to challenge societal norms, creating a more inclusive space in the traditionally male-dominated weight room.

Unveiling the Mystery: Why Am I Gaining Weight? The Relationship Between Muscle Gain and Fat Loss

Are you hitting the gym regularly, eating well, and yet find the scale inching upwards? The mystery of weight gain can be perplexing, but it might not be as straightforward as it seems. In this comprehensive guide, we'll delve into the intricate relationship between muscle gain and fat loss, shedding light on why your efforts might be contributing to weight gain and why that might actually be a positive sign for your overall health.

1. The Initial Concern: Why Am I Gaining Weight Despite My Healthy Lifestyle?

It's not uncommon for individuals on a fitness journey to feel disheartened when the numbers on the scale start to climb. The initial concern often revolves around questioning the efficacy of their healthy lifestyle choices. However, weight gain doesn't necessarily equate to an increase in body fat.

2. Distinguishing Between Muscle and Fat: Understanding the Basics

To understand weight gain accurately, it's crucial to distinguish between muscle and fat. Muscle is denser than fat, and as you build muscle mass through exercise, your weight may increase, even as your body fat percentage decreases.

3. Metabolic Magic: How Muscle Affects Your Fat-Burning Potential

One of the key relationships between muscle gain and fat loss lies in your metabolism. Muscle is metabolically active tissue, meaning it burns more calories at rest compared to fat. As you gain muscle, your body's metabolism gets a boost, enhancing its ability to burn fat even when you're not actively exercising.

4. The Culprit Scale: Why It Might Not Tell the Whole Story

Relying solely on the scale to measure progress can be misleading. Muscle gain can offset fat loss, and the scale might not reflect the positive changes happening in your body composition. Exploring alternative methods of tracking progress, such as body measurements and photos, can provide a more comprehensive picture.

5. The Role of Resistance Training: Building Muscle for a Leaner Physique

Incorporating resistance training into your fitness routine is a game-changer when it comes to the relationship between muscle gain and fat loss. Strength training not only builds muscle but also stimulates the metabolism, facilitating fat loss over time.

6. Nutritional Considerations: Eating for Muscle Growth and Fat Loss

Nutrition plays a pivotal role in the intricate dance between muscle gain and fat loss. Consuming an adequate amount of protein is crucial for muscle development, while a balanced diet ensures your body has the necessary nutrients to function optimally and support your fitness goals.

7. Patience and Persistence: Overcoming Frustrations in Your Fitness Journey

Weight fluctuations are a normal part of the fitness journey, and patience is key. The initial weight gain might be a result of water retention or increased glycogen storage in muscles. Understanding that transformations take time and celebrating non-scale victories can help you stay motivated.
